Whakarāpopototanga matua

Executive summary

2.      Most workshops are open to the public to attend as observers in person or online.

3.       Some sessions may not be open to the public. The staff / chairperson and deputy chairperson decide which sessions are open to the public, depending on the sensitivity of the information being discussed. If a session is not open, a reason will be provided below.

4.       Local board workshops provide an opportunity for local boards to carry out their governance role in the following areas:

a)   Accountability to the public.

b)   Engagement.

c)   Input to regional decision-making.

d)   Keeping informed.

e)   Local initiative / preparing for specific decisions.

f)    Oversight and monitoring.

g)   Setting direction / priorities / budget.

5.       Workshops do not have decision-making authority.

6.       Workshops are used to canvass issues, prepare local board members for upcoming decisions and to enable discussion between elected members and staff.

7.       Members are respectfully reminded of their Code of Conduct obligations with respect to conflicts of interest and confidentiality.
